Relationship between cardiac cycle and ECG:
The cardiac cycle attributes to a comprehensive heartbeat from its production to the commencement of the next beat. The cardiac cycle involves a complete contraction and relaxation of both the atria and ventricles and the cycle last approximately 0.8 seconds.
The electrocardiogram, or ECG, is a graphical representation of the heart's electrical exertion during the cardiac cycle.
The letters P to T represent each peak in the ECG
P-wave – atria depolarization or atrial contraction.
Depolarization of the ventricles or ventricular compression is the QRS complex.
